This project involved the supply of indoor dry type transformers and low voltage switchgear for a data center power room in Singapore. The equipment was selected to support critical power distribution, indoor installation requirements and coordinated connection with the downstream UPS and facility electrical systems.
Before production, the project specification, single-line diagram and switchroom layout were reviewed to confirm transformer capacity, voltage ratio, cooling arrangement, enclosure requirement, LV busbar rating, incoming protection, outgoing feeder arrangement and cable entry direction.
The transformer and switchgear package was manufactured with the required inspection records, drawings and technical documents before shipment, helping the project team reduce approval and installation uncertainty.

Voltage, capacity, and protection parameters confirmed for this project.
| Parameter | Value |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Transformer Capacity | 2000 kVA | Per transformer |
| Primary Voltage | 22 kV | Medium voltage side |
| Secondary Voltage | 0.4 kV | Low voltage side |
| Frequency | 50 Hz | According to project requirement |
| Transformer Type | Cast resin dry type | Indoor oil-free installation |
| Cooling Method | AN / AF | Natural air with forced air cooling provision |
| Temperature Monitoring | PT100 with temperature controller | Alarm and trip contacts prepared |
| Enclosure Protection | IP31 | Indoor transformer enclosure |
| LV Switchgear Rated Voltage | 400 V | Low voltage distribution system |
| LV Switchgear Rated Current | 3200 A | Main busbar rating |
| Short-circuit Current | 65 kA / 1s | According to project fault level requirement |
| Incoming Protection | ACB with metering | Confirmed according to the SLD |
| Cable Entry | Top and bottom entry | Confirmed according to switchroom layout |

<p>The project required an indoor oil-free transformer and low voltage switchgear package suitable for a data center power room. Key items needed confirmation before production, including transformer capacity, ventilation space, enclosure protection, LV busbar rating, feeder arrangement, incoming protection, cable entry direction, monitoring contacts and document approval requirements.</p>
Our engineering team reviewed the specification, SLD and switchroom arrangement before preparing the technical proposal. The dry type transformer configuration, enclosure, cooling arrangement, temperature monitoring, LV switchgear feeder schedule and protection requirements were checked against the project documents.
Based on the confirmed requirements, we prepared a coordinated transformer and LV switchgear package with datasheets, arrangement drawings, wiring references, testing documents and shipment support to reduce approval and installation risk.

Inspection items and engineering documents prepared for this project.
<p>Routine tests and factory checks were completed before shipment. The dry type transformers were checked for winding resistance, voltage ratio, insulation resistance, applied voltage, induced voltage and temperature control function. The LV switchgear panels were checked for mechanical operation, wiring continuity, protection device arrangement, insulation resistance and power frequency withstand voltage.</p>
